Senior Software Engineer - C

ION Corporates
Full-time
Uniondale, New York
$115,000 - $150,000
Posted on a month ago

Job Description

As a Senior Software Engineer, you will design, develop, and maintain commodity/energy production, trading, and logistics products in an agile environment, collaborating with cross-functional teams to deliver high-quality software solutions. The role requires strong problem-solving skills, communication, and adaptability.

Responsibilities

  • Design and develop software using coding standards and design patterns
  • Diagnose and debug software using debugging tools
  • Interact with business experts and customers to understand requirements
  • Collaborate with local and remote team members
  • Promote best practices in coding, design, and architecture
  • Contribute to developing and refining development processes
  • Coach and mentor junior team members
  • Participate in architecture discussions
  • Participate in stakeholder and customer conversations

Requirements

  • BS degree in Computer Science
  • 6+ years of experience in coding and designing enterprise applications
  • Strong programming skills in C
  • Experience developing SQL and working with relational databases
  • Strong analytical and problem-solving skills
  • Excellent communication skills
  • Experience working in an agile team setting

Benefits

  • No benefits